Toth Financial Advisory Corp Has $1.49 Million Stake in Kimberly-Clark Corporation $KMB

Toth Financial Advisory Corp cut its stake in shares of Kimberly-Clark Corporation (NASDAQ:KMBFree Report) by 29.2%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 13,576 shares of the company’s stock after selling 5,596 shares during the quarter. Toth Financial Advisory Corp’s holdings in Kimberly-Clark were worth $1,490,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Kimberly-Clark Trading Down 0.4%

NASDAQ KMB opened at $109.55 on Friday. The company has a quick ratio of 0.69, a current ratio of 0.91 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 3.45. Kimberly-Clark Corporation has a 52 week low of $92.42 and a 52 week high of $131.53. The business has a 50 day moving average price of $109.66 and a 200-day moving average price of $103.71. The company has a market cap of $36.43 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 18.63, a P/E/G ratio of 5.24 and a beta of 0.26.

Kimberly-Clark (NASDAQ:KMBG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, August 4th. The company reported $1.80 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$2.01 by ($0.21). Kimberly-Clark had a return on equity of 143.92% and a net margin of 11.79%.The business had revenue of $4.19 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$4.22 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ted $1.92 EPS. The business’s quarterly revenue was up .6%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, equities analysts expect that Kimberly-Clark Corporation will post 7.42 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Kimberly-Clark Announces Dividend

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, October 2nd. Stockholders of record on Friday, September 4th will be given a dividend of $1.28 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, September 4th. This represents a $5.12 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.7%. Kimberly-Clark’s payout ratio is presently 87.07%.

Kimberly-Clark Profile

Kimberly-Clark Corporation is a U.S.-based multinational manufacturer of personal care and consumer tissue products. The company develops, produces and markets a range of consumer brands and professional products, including facial and bathroom tissues, disposable diapers and training pants, feminine care, incontinence products and workplace hygiene solutions. Known for consumer-facing names such as Kleenex, Huggies, Kotex, Cottonelle and Scott, as well as professional offerings under Kimberly-Clark Professional and KleenGuard, the company supplies goods to retail, healthcare and institutional customers.

Founded in 1872 in Neenah, Wisconsin, Kimberly-Clark has expanded from its 19th-century paper-making roots into a global household and workplace products company.
